Video Sources 26 Views

  • 2ru2cc
  • SERVER US HD

Da Vinci’s Demons Full TV Series | where to watch?: 3x9

Angelus Iratissimus

Leo and Sophia struggle to control the mysterious device they’ve built. Back in Florence, Riario awaits judgment while Lorenzo and Vanessa take their partnership to the next level.

Da Vinci’s Demons: 3×9
Dec. 19, 2015

Leave a comment

Name *
Add a display name
Email *
Your email address will not be published